to answer some of the questions:

im not in a major right now...im still in the foundations dept. of my school. ill probably go into industial design or our technology interdisciplinary program.

website stuff-ill definitely look into moving my site over to liquid2k...i really hate all the banners on my site. also im going to add thumbnail pages for each section.

the robots in the illustration section were done with prismacolor markers, 30%, 50%, and 70% cool grey. and then a micron pen for fine lines...for info, check out doug chiang's website, www.dchiang.com, and he has a whole marker tutorial, if you havent seen it already.

the torso sculpture was something i made in high school. its regular pottery clay, that i added wire to after firing, and then painted. ive made several of these, ill try to get a few others up soon

digital illustrations- yes i have done some digital work...im going to get that up soon too

about my pencil tones- those were all done with a regular HB or a black color pencil.
pens- i usually use whatever i can get my hands on...lots of microns or uni-balls. oh yeah, whats a stomph?

A stomph is a little stick. =)

It looks like paper mass rolled into a stick (which is probably what it is too)

You use it to smudge out pencils or charcoal or whatever, and you get a really nice smooth shading. It works sort of like photoshops blur tool...
